SM 400XLR
Dynamic super-cardiod microphone, with On/Off switch, microphone clamp, flexible XLR-XLR cable (6.5m).
SAFETY INFORMATION
• Protect the microphone from moisture, liquids, fire and sudden impacts. Exposing it to such elements
could damage the microphone.
• Do not blow into the microphone to test/check the same. It is advisable to carry out a speech trial.
• When using wired microphones always ensure that the microphone cable is laid so that it does not
present a hazard.
FEATURES
• High quality microphone for superior vocal reproduction.
• Extra wide frequency response (40Hz~16KHz) designed to suit every professional vocal applications.
• Dynamic super- cardioid pickup pattern minimizes off-axis pick-up, reduced feedback and higher
system gain.
• Suspended cartridge shock-mount system, to minimize handling noise.
• Low-failure magnetic on-off switch.
• Rugged body and dent-proof steel grill that withstands, physical shocks.
• Comes with a 6.5M flexible XLR-F to XLR-M mic cable, mic holder & plastic case.
CONNECTION
The SM400XLR is supplied with a 3-pin XLR Plug to connect to any microphone input (on a professional
mixer, amplifier, processor etc).
MAINTENANCE
For cleaning the microphone body and basket use a soft, damp cloth. If necessary use a mild cleansing
agent. No solvent agents should be used. Take care not to allow any water into the microphone.
